This three bedroom, two bathroom split level home, complete with a detached flexible use room offering additional versatility, is thoughtfully positioned into the side of the hill, elevated to capture the outlook across its 7,722sqm parcel.
Set comfortably within its surrounds, the home offers easy living and welcoming spaces to enjoy throughout.
A decked pathway guides you to the generous front entertaining area, where the view opens up and sets the tone for what this property is all about. Step inside to the main living and dining area featuring warm Jarrah flooring and a vaulted timber ceiling that enhances the sense of space and light. A wood fire creates a cosy focal point, complemented by reverse cycle heating and cooling for year round comfort.
The kitchen sits to the left of the living space, positioned to take in the outlook while remaining practical and functional. Tucked neatly behind is the laundry, complete with a private toilet.
Upstairs on the bedroom level, you will find two carpeted bedrooms, one with a built in wardrobe, along with the main bathroom offering a bath, shower and vanity.
The main bedroom provides a comfortable space, complete with built in wardrobe, ensuite with shower, vanity and toilet, and a door leading out to the verandah with step down access.
Adding further flexibility is a separate additional room detached from the home but situated under the deck. Currently utilised as an office, this versatile space could easily serve as a teenage retreat, hobby room or guest accommodation. It includes a wall mounted electric heater for comfort.
Outdoors, the lifestyle appeal continues. The fully fenced paddock with gated access offers room for a couple of sheep, a horse, or simply space to enjoy. The current owner has carefully maintained the trees and pathways, complete with reticulation and several peaceful spots to sit and take in the outlook. A gazebo provides one setting, while a grapevine drapes over a sweet timber seat, creating another inviting corner of the property.
Practical features include:
• 6 x 6 two car garage with electric door plus additional outside parking space for two more vehicles
• Garden shed
• Electric hot water system
